Reuse_alv_variant_default_get
-To get the default variant for the ALV display
Reuse_alv_variant_F4
- To get the list of ALV variants in the F4 Help
Reuse_alv_variant_existence
- Check the existence of an ALV variant
Reuse_alv_events_get
- Get the list of events for the ALV display
Reuse_alv_commentary_write
- To write a header to the ALV display
Reuse_alv_fieldcatalog_merge
- To build the fieldcatalog from the structure/table
Reuse_alv_list_display
- Display a ALV list
Reuse_alv_popup_to_select
- Display a popup ALV display which allows to select one or more values from the list

Reuse_alv_variant_default_get:
Provides the default variant for the list specified in the structure parameter CS_VARIANT of a program.
Reuse_alv_variant_F4:
Display variant selection dialog box. Possible entries help, if the variant is defined explicitly as an input field on a screen. The selection must be specified by at least partially filling the parameter structure IS_VARIANT.
Reuse_alv_variant_existence:
This function module checks the existence in the database of a display variant passed in the interface.
Reuse_alv_events_get:
Returns table of possible events for a list type.This table can be passed to the ALV display module with the form name.
Reuse_alv_commentary_write:
List body comment block output.List header information is output according to its type. The output information is put in an internal table. Output attributes are assigned to each line via the TYP field.
This module outputs formatted simple header information at TOP-OF-PAGE.
Reuse_alv_fieldcatalog_merge:
Create field catalog from dictionary structure or internal table.Supports the creation of the field catalog for the ALV function modules based either on a structure or table defined in the ABAP Data Dictionary, or a program-internal table.
Reuse_alv_list_display:
Output a simple list (single line or several lines).This module outputs an internal table with any structure as a formatted one-line or multiple-line list.
Principle:
Pass an internal table with the set of output information
Pass a structure with general list layout details
Pass a field catalog as an internal table
The field catalog describes the fields to be output in the list.
Reuse_alv_popup_to_select:
List in dialog box to choose one or more entries (or display only).Module for displaying or selecting table entries in internal tables in a popup (single or multiple selection is possible).
Principle:
pass an internal table with the superset of information to be output
pass list layout detail flags
pass a field catalog in the form of an internal table
The field catalog describes the fields to be output in the list.
Also check the FM documentation for each.

ABAP List Viewer
The common features of report are column alignment, sorting, filtering, subtotals, totals etc. To implement these, a lot of coding and logic is to be put. To avoid that we can use a concept called ABAP List Viewer (ALV).
This helps us to implement all the features mentioned very effectively.
Using ALV, We can have three types of reports:
1. Simple Report
2. Block Report
3. Hierarchical Sequential Report
There are some function modules which will enable to produce the above reports without much effort.
All the definitions of internal tables, structures and constants are declared in a type-pool called SLIS.
1. SIMPLE REPORT.
The important function modules are
a. Reuse_alv_list_display
b. Reuse_alv_fieldcatalog_merge
c. Reuse_alv_events_get
d. Reuse_alv_commentary_write
e. Reuse_alv_grid_display
A. REUSE_ALV_LIST_DISPLAY : This is the function module which prints the data.
The important parameters are :
I. Export :
i. I_callback_program : report id
ii. I_callback_pf_status_set : routine where a user can set his own pf status or change the functionality of the existing pf status
iii. I_callback_user_command : routine where the function codes are handled
iv. I_structure name : name of the dictionary table
v. Is_layout : structure to set the layout of the report
vi. It_fieldcat : internal table with the list of all fields and their attributes which are to be printed (this table can be populated automatically by the function module REUSE_ALV_FIELDCATALOG_MERGE
vii. It_events : internal table with a list of all possible events of ALV and their corresponding form names.
II. Tables :
i. t_outtab : internal table with the data to be output
B. REUSE_ALV_FIELDCATALOG_MERGE : This function module is used to populate a fieldcatalog which is essential to display the data in ALV. If the output data is from a single dictionary table and all the columns are selected, then we need not exclusively create the field catalog. Its enough to mention the table name as a parameter(I_structure name) in the REUSE_ALV_LIST_DISPLAY. But in other cases we need to create it.
The Important Parameters are :
I. Export :
i. I_program_name : report id
ii. I_internal_tabname : the internal output table
iii. I_inclname : include or the report name where all the dynamic forms are handled.
II Changing
ct_fieldcat : an internal table with the type SLIS_T_FIELDCAT_ALV which is
declared in the type pool SLIS.
C. REUSE_ALV_EVENTS_GET : Returns table of possible events for a list type
Parameters :
I. Import :
Et_Events : The event table is returned with all possible CALLBACK events
for the specified list type (column 'NAME'). For events to be processed by Callback, their 'FORM' field must be filled. If the field is initialized, the event is ignored. The entry can be read from the event table, the field 'FORM' filled and the entry modified using constants from the type pool SALV.
II. Export :
I_List_type :
0 = simple list REUSE_ALV_LIST_DISPLAY
1 = hierarchcal-sequential list REUSE_ALV_HIERSEQ_LIST_DISPLAY
2 = simple block list REUSE_ALV_BLOCK_LIST_APPEND
3 = hierarchical-sequential block list
REUSE_ALV_BLOCK_LIST_HS_APPEND
D. REUSE_ALV_COMMENTARY_WRITE : This is used in the Top-of-page event to print the headings and other comments for the list.
Parameters :
I. it_list_commentary : internal table with the headings of the type slis_t_listheader.
This internal table has three fields :
Typ : H header, S selection , A - action
Key : only when typ is S.
Info : the text to be printed
E. REUSE_ALV_GRID_DISPLAY : A new function in 4.6 version, to display the results in grid rather than as a preview.
Parameters : same as reuse_alv_list_display

2. BLOCK REPORT
This is used to have multiple lists continuously.
The important functions used in this report are:
A. REUSE_ALV_BLOCK_LIST_INIT
B. REUSE_ALV_BLOCK_LIST_APPEND
C. REUSE_ALV_BLOCK_LIST_HS_APPEND
D. REUSE_ALV_BLOCK_LIST_DISPLAY
A. REUSE_ALV_BLOCK_LIST_INIT
Parameters:
I. I_CALLBACK_PROGRAM
II. I_CALLBACK_PF_STATUS_SET
III. I_CALLBACK_USER_COMMAND
This function module is used to set the default gui status etc.
B. REUSE_ALV_BLOCK_LIST_APPEND
Parameters :
Export :
I. is_layout : layout settings for block
II. it_fieldcat : field catalog
III. i_tabname : internal table name with output data
IV. it_events : internal table with all possible events
Tables :
i. t_outtab : internal table with output data.
This function module adds the data to the block.
Repeat this function for all the different blocks to be displayed one after the other.
C. REUSE_ALV_BLOCK_LIST_HS_APPEND
This function module is used for hierarchical sequential blocks.
D. REUSE_ALV_BLOCK_LIST_DISPLAY
Parameters : All the parameters are optional.
This function module display the list with data appended by the above function.
Here the functions REUSE_ALV_FIELDCATALOG_MERGE, REUSE_ALV_EVENTS_GET, REUSE_ALV_COMMENTARY_WRITE can be used.
3. Hierarchical reports :
Hierarchical sequential list output.
The function module is
A. REUSE_ALV_HIERSEQ_LIST_DISPLAY
Parameters:
I. Export:
i. I_CALLBACK_PROGRAM
ii. I_CALLBACK_PF_STATUS_SET
iii. I_CALLBACK_USER_COMMAND
iv. IS_LAYOUT
v. IT_FIELDCAT
vi. IT_EVENTS
vii. i_tabname_header : Name of the internal table in the program containing the
output data of the highest hierarchy level.
viii. i_tabname_item : Name of the internal table in the program containing the
output data of the lowest hierarchy level.
ix. is_keyinfo : This structure contains the header and item table field
names which link the two tables (shared key).
II. Tables
i. t_outtab_header : Header table with data to be output
ii. t_outtab_item : Name of the internal table in the program containing the
output data of the lowest hierarchy level.
slis_t_fieldcat_alv : This internal table contains the field attributes. This internal table can be populated automatically by using REUSE_ALV_FIELDCATALOG_MERGE.
Important Attributes :
A. col_pos : position of the column
B. fieldname : internal fieldname
C. tabname : internal table name
D. ref_fieldname : fieldname (dictionary)
E. ref_tabname : table (dictionary)
F. key(1) : column with key-color
G. icon(1) : icon
H. symbol(1) : symbol
I. checkbox(1) : checkbox
J. just(1) : (R)ight (L)eft (C)ent.
K. do_sum(1) : sum up
L. no_out(1) : (O)blig.(X)no out
M. outputlen : output length
N. seltext_l : long key word
O. seltext_m : middle key word
P. seltext_s : short key word
Q. reptext_ddic : heading (ddic)
R. ddictxt(1) : (S)hort (M)iddle (L)ong
S. datatype : datatype
T. hotspot(1) : hotspot
